Dissolved Oxygen, Vacu-vials Instrumental Kit, CHEMetrics
Dissolved Oxygen in water test kits for environmental and drinking water applications (ppm range) employ the indigo carmine method. The reduced form of indigo carmine reacts with D.O. to form a blue product. The indigo carmine methodology is not subject to interferences from temperature, salinity, or dissolved gases such as sulfide, which plague users of D.O. meters.
